I want to move my VM system to a new array, and subsequently removing
the old array. I was thinking of having z/OS use ADRDSSU to copy the VM
volumes from the old array to the new one - while the VM system was
down. There have been some issues in the past that indicate this won't
work. Is this still the case? If not, are there any special parms that
need to be passed to ADRDSSU to copy the VM volumes? If there still are
issues, how would I accomplish this without having a running VM system
to do it?
